Cidgaganacandrika 186 [Praise of worship of Shakti by Mantra, Yantra and Tantras], English comparative study extracted from the two available commentaries—the Divyacakorika and the Kramaprakashika. The Cidgagana-candrika is an important Tantric work belonging to the Krama system of Kashmir Shaivism. Written by Kalidasa (Shrivatsa) in 312 Sanskrit verses, it deals with the knowledge regarding both the Macrocosmic and Microcosmic phenomena

[Praise of worship of Śپ by Mantra, Yantra and Tantras]

Bindu is the source for the various ṣa (lipi) arising out of its swelling effect. Mantras and Yantras for invoking various Gods and Goddesses are formed of these ṣa only. The yantras are made of various materials like Mud, Stone, Cloth, Iron, Copper, Silver and Gold.
